Interesting exprience Sunday.
I use the Pillsbury Hot Roll Mix with a few modifications for my Cinnamon Rolls.
TNT! Success every time. Very easy. Rolls light and very tasty.
I usually add my liquid ingredients,(egg, water and butter) together and bring them up to 115 F.
Mix my dry ingredients (yeast, flour, sugar (1T light brown sugar 1T regular cane sugar) ¼ t Cinnamon) , then incorperate the liquid ingredients.
After turning the dough out on my board and started the kneading I noticed the texture didn't feel right.
A quick review of the ingredients revealed I had forgotten the EGG.
Either toss the batch OR ADD the EGG.
I opted to add the EGG. A little slick, sticky, slimly mess but continued mixing with a kneading action, I finally got the egg worked in to my satisfaction.
IT WORKED!!!!
Don't be afraid to try a fix on a GOOF-UP
